


	* {
		padding: 0;
		margin: 0;
		border: 0;
		text-decoration: none;
		font-weight: normal;
		font-style: normal;
		font-family: Arial, Helvetica, Verdana, sans-serif;
		font-size: 14px;
		color: #fff;
		outline: 0;
		list-style: none;
	}

	strong {
		font-weight: bold;
	}

	em {
		font-style: italic;
	}

	html, body {
		width: 100%;
	}

	body {
		background: #1b2a2c url(http://tumblrmeetupberlin.sonntagslounge.de/imgs/bg_body.jpg) center top no-repeat;
	}

	br.clear {
		display: block;
		height: 1px;
		overflow: hidden;
		clear: both;
	}








	div#container {
		margin: 80px auto;
		width: 500px;
	}

	h1 {
		height: 135px;
		text-align: center;
	}

	div.box {
		background: url(http://tumblrmeetupberlin.sonntagslounge.de/imgs/bg_semiblack.png);
		margin-bottom: 30px;
		padding: 30px 20px 10px 30px;
	}

	div.box p {
		margin-bottom: 20px;
		line-height: 22px;
	}

	div.box strong.q {
		font-weight: bold;
	}

	div.box span.a {
		font-size: 18px;
		background: #fff;
		color: #000;
		padding: 2px 3px;
	}

	div.box a {
		text-decoration: underline;
	}

	div.box a:hover, div.box a:focus, div.box a:active {
	}

	div.box p.post-info a {
		font-size: 11px;
		color: #92a1a3;
		border: 0;
	}

	div.box p.post-info a:hover, div.box p.post-info a:focus, div.box p.post-info a:active {
		color: #fff;
	}




	div#footer {
		text-align: center;
		padding-bottom: 30px;
	}

	div#footer * {
		font-size: 11px;
		color: #92a1a3;
		text-transform: uppercase;
	}

	div#footer a:hover, div#footer a:focus, div#footer a:active {
		color: #fff;
	}



	form label {
		font-style: italic;
		font-size: 12px;
	}

	form input {
		display: block;
		width: 391px;
		height: 27px;
		background: url(http://tumblrmeetupberlin.sonntagslounge.de/imgs/bg_input.png) left top no-repeat;
		padding: 10px 10px 0 10px;
		font-family: Georgia, Times New Roman, serif;
		margin-top: 4px;
		margin-left: -5px;
		color: #8a8a8a;
	}

	form p.submit input {
		display: block;
		width: 66px;
		height: 27px;
		overflow: hidden;
		line-height: 0;
		text-indent: -200000em;
		font-size: 0;
		background: url(http://tumblrmeetupberlin.sonntagslounge.de/imgs/bg_submit.png) no-repeat;
		cursor: pointer;
	}








	div.box table {
		margin-bottom: 20px;
		width: 100%;
	}

	div.box table th {
		padding: 5px 0 10px 0;
		text-align: left;
		text-transform: uppercase;
		font-weight: bold;
	}

	div.box table th._1 {
		width: 70%;
	}

	div.box table th._2 {
		width: 30%;
	}

	div.box table td {
		padding: 2px 0;
	}

	div.box table td a {
		border: 0;
	}










	body.site_panorama div#footer {
		margin-top: 350px;
	}

	div#pano {
		position: absolute;
		top: 220px;
		left: 0;
		width: 100%;
		overflow: auto;
		height: 320px;
	}

	div#panolinks {
		position: absolute;
		top: 0;
		left: 0;
		width: 100%;
		height: 300px;
	}

	div#panolinks a {
		position: absolute;
	}

	a#l_km {
		top: 184px;
		left: 82px;
	}

	a#l_at {
		top: 9px;
		left: 246px;
	}

	a#l_wn {
		top: 248px;
		left: 484px;
	}

	a#l_bc {
		top: 12px;
		left: 694px;
	}

	a#l_sw {
		top: 183px;
		left: 929px;
	}

	a#l_ru {
		top: 151px;
		left: 1141px;
	}

	a#l_el {
		top: 18px;
		left: 1243px;
	}

	a#l_sb {
		top: 13px;
		left: 1407px;
	}

	a#l_jd {
		top: 124px;
		left: 1354px;
	}

	a#l_ts {
		top: 165px;
		left: 1510px;
	}

	a#l_lo {
		top: 229px;
		left: 1727px;
	}